> > > This is not how this debugfs node works. This is meant to be used
> > > while
> > > running
> > > DP compliance video pattern test.
> > > 
> > > https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/drm/igt-gpu-tools/-/blob/master/tools/msm_dp_compliance.c
> > > 
> > > While the compliance test is being run with this msm_dp_compliance app
> > > running,
> > > it will draw the test pattern when it gets the "test_active" from the
> > > driver.
> > > 
> > > The test pattern which this app draws is as per the requirements of
> > > the
> > > compliance test
> > > as the test equipment will match the CRC of the pattern which is
> > > drawn.
> > > 
> > > The API dp_panel_tpg_config() which you are trying to call here
> > > draws the DP
> > > test pattern
> > > from the DP controller hardware but not the pattern which the
> > > compliance
> > > test expects.

> There are two test patterns with different purposes. The one which the
> msm_dp_compliance
> draws is strictly for the DP compliance test and it needs even the DPU to
> draw the frame because
> it sets up the display pipeline and just draws the buffer.
> 
> That is not what you are looking for here.
> 
> So rather than trying to run msm_dp_compliance on your setup, just try
> calling dp_panel_tpg_config().
> We typically just call this API, right after the link training is done.
> But if you really need a debugfs node for this, you can write up a separate
> debugfs for it
> Something like:
> 
> echo 1 > dp/tpg/en
